The Trinity Christian Academy Eagles will venture away from home to square off against the East Ridge Knights at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Having both just faced considerable losses, both teams are looking to turn things around.
Trinity Christian Academy's last matchup with Orangewood Christian could've gone either way, but unfortunately the same can't be said for the pair's matchup on Tuesday. Trinity Christian Academy came up short against Orangewood Christian, falling 13-3. The defeat continues a trend for the Eagles in their meetings with the Rams: they've now lost eight in a row.

Trinity Christian Academy saw four different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Kyle Kuczynski, who scored a run while going 2-for-3. Those two hits gave Kuczynski a new career-high. Another was Liam Callahan, who got on base in all three of his plate appearances with one RBI.
Even though they lost, Trinity Christian Academy hit smart and finished the game with only two strikeouts. This was only their first loss (out of three games) when they post two or more strikeouts.
Meanwhile, Friday just wasn't the day for East Ridge's offense. They lost 15-0 to Lake Minneola on Friday. The Knights' loss continues a trend for the team, making it five in a row.
Trinity Christian Academy's defeat dropped their record down to 3-10. As for East Ridge, their loss dropped their record down to 6-10.
Trinity Christian Academy came up short against East Ridge when the teams last played back in April of 2023, falling 4-1. Can Trinity Christian Academy av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
